<h3>Overview</h3>
<p>Abiraterone acetate is a potent oral inhibitor of <strong>CYP17A1</strong>, an enzyme critical for androgen biosynthesis. Synthesized via chemical acetylation, its molecular formula is C<sub>23</sub>H<sub>30</sub>O<sub>3</sub> with CAS No. 154229-19-3.</p>
<h3>Application</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Oncology:</strong> First-line treatment for met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C).</li>
<li><strong>Endocrinology:</strong> Management of hormone-dependent tumors requiring androgen suppression.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Precautions</h3>
<p>Mandatory co-administration with prednisone is required to prevent mineralocorticoid excess. Store in tightly sealed containers at controlled room temperature (20-25°C) away from moisture and light. Handle with appropriate PPE due to potential reproductive toxicity.</p>
